Actual Warranty

A promise or guarantee provided by a seller regarding the condition and functionality of a product.

Implied Warranty

A warranty that is imposed by law rather than by statements, descriptions, or samples given by the seller.

C.P.A.

Stands for Certified Public Accountant, a designation given to someone who has passed the Uniform CPA Examination and met additional state education and experience requirements.

Tax Liability

The total amount of tax owed by an individual, corporation, or other entity to a taxing authority.
